tatara_process/lifetime_clock.rs
1//! Ephemeral lifetime clock — TTL expiry + teardown-policy decisions.
2//!
3//! The reconciler consults this module at each phase tick to decide
4//! whether a Process should auto-terminate:
5//! - TTL is measured from `metadata.creation_timestamp` (the most
6//! deterministic anchor — phaseSince resets per phase).
7//! - Teardown policy applies on `Attested` or `Failed` per
8//! `EphemeralLifetime.teardown_policy`.
9//!
10//! Returning `AutoTerminate::Now { reason }` tells the caller to transition
11//! the Process to `Exiting`. The phase machine handles the SIGTERM path
12//! from there (children drained, finalizer guards owned resources).

280/// Inspect a Process at the given current phase and return whether the
281/// ephemeral lifetime clock fires now.
282///
283/// `now` is injected so unit tests can drive the clock deterministically.
284pub fn evaluate(
285 process: &Process,
286 current_phase: ProcessPhase,
287 now: DateTime<Utc>,
288) -> AutoTerminate {
289 // Closed-set projection: ambiguous → no-op; permanent → no-op;
290 // ephemeral → fall through to teardown / TTL checks. ONE
291 // `Process::resolved_ephemeral` gate — the compound spec-projection
292 // primitive on `impl Process` that owns the ambiguity-aware
293 // `variant().ok() + as_ephemeral` chain — replaces the previous
294 // 4-step `process.spec.lifetime.resolved_ephemeral()` walk and
295 // shares the primitive with `requeue_with_ttl` below AND with
296 // `tatara-reconciler::render::render_export_jobs` (which pre-
297 // lift walked the naked `.spec.lifetime.ephemeral.as_ref()`
298 // raw-field access that disagreed on the ambiguous corner).
299 let Some(ephemeral) = process.resolved_ephemeral() else {
300 return AutoTerminate::Skip;
301 };
302
303 // 1. Teardown policy on terminal phases — ONE typed dispatch over
304 // `(TeardownPolicy, ProcessPhase)` replaces the previous pair of
305 // near-identical Attested/Failed branches. Non-terminal phases
306 // short-circuit inside `should_teardown_on`. The reason is the
307 // typed `TerminateReason::TeardownPolicy` variant whose `Display`
308 // composes the operator-visible string against the canonical
309 // PascalCase projection (`TeardownPolicy::as_str` +
310 // `ProcessPhase::as_str`), not a free-form template.
311 if ephemeral.teardown_policy.should_teardown_on(current_phase) {
312 return AutoTerminate::Now {
313 reason: TerminateReason::TeardownPolicy {
314 policy: ephemeral.teardown_policy,
315 phase: current_phase,
316 },
317 };
318 }
319
320 // 2. TTL expiry — applies in any non-terminal phase.
321 // The creation-anchor probe rides through the ONE substrate
322 // `Process::created_at` primitive, sibling to the same-corner
323 // requeue-budget picker in `requeue_with_ttl` below and the
324 // stable-name claim-arbiter tie-break seed in
325 // `tatara-reconciler::table_controller`. Post-lift the two
326 // consumers here + downstream share the ONE
327 // `Option<DateTime<Utc>>` return shape.
328 if !is_terminal_or_exit(current_phase) {
329 if let Some(creation) = process.created_at() {
330 // TTL parse rides through the ONE substrate primitive
331 // [`crate::lifetime::EphemeralLifetime::ttl_duration`] —
332 // the `humantime::parse_duration(&<eph>.ttl).ok()` chain
333 // pre-lift hand-authored at TWO workspace-wide sites past
334 // the ★★ PRIME-DIRECTIVE ≥ 2 duplication threshold
335 // (peer at [`requeue_with_ttl`] below). Post-lift both
336 // consumers share ONE typed owner returning the same
337 // `Option<Duration>` shape [`crate::time::elapsed_since`]
338 // returns, so the `elapsed >= ttl` comparator lands with
339 // both operands on the same axis; a future TTL-side
340 // normalization (per-fleet minimum floor, canonical
341 // unit-normalization, warn-log on unparseable strings)
342 // lands at ONE substrate site.
343 if let Some(ttl) = ephemeral.ttl_duration() {
344 // The `(now, creation) → Option<std::time::Duration>`
345 // projection rides through the ONE substrate primitive
346 // [`crate::time::elapsed_since`], sibling to the same-
347 // chain sleep-budget picker in [`requeue_with_ttl`]
348 // below and the pool-staleness gate in
349 // `tatara-pool-reconciler::pool_decide`. Pre-lift each
350 // of the three sites hand-authored `now
351 // .signed_duration_since(<anchor>).to_std().ok()` past
352 // the ★★ PRIME-DIRECTIVE ≥ 2 duplication threshold;
353 // post-lift each routes through ONE typed owner and a
354 // future normalization (monotonic-clock cross-check,
355 // per-fleet skew tolerance, subsecond truncation) lands
356 // at ONE substrate site.
357 if let Some(elapsed) = crate::time::elapsed_since(now, creation) {
358 if elapsed >= ttl {
359 return AutoTerminate::Now {
360 reason: TerminateReason::TtlExpired {
361 ttl: ephemeral.ttl.clone(),
362 elapsed,
363 },
364 };
365 }
366 }
367 }
368 }
369 }
370
371 AutoTerminate::Skip
372}
373
374/// Phases past which TTL cannot meaningfully fire — the SIGTERM path
375/// is already in progress.
376fn is_terminal_or_exit(p: ProcessPhase) -> bool {
377 matches!(
378 p,
379 ProcessPhase::Exiting | ProcessPhase::Zombie | ProcessPhase::Reaped
380 )
381}
382
383/// Sleep budget the controller should requeue with for a Process whose
384/// `evaluate()` returned `Skip` — picks the smaller of HEARTBEAT and
385/// TTL-remaining so we don't oversleep past expiry.
386pub fn requeue_with_ttl(process: &Process, now: DateTime<Utc>, default: Duration) -> Duration {
387 // Shared `Process::resolved_ephemeral` projection with
388 // [`evaluate`] — the "give me only the unambiguous ephemeral case"
389 // compound-lift primitive on `impl Process` that composes through
390 // `impl Lifetime`'s `resolved_ephemeral` and closes drift with the
391 // export-Job render arm at ONE substrate site.
392 let Some(e) = process.resolved_ephemeral() else {
393 return default;
394 };
395 // Creation-anchor probe rides through the ONE substrate
396 // `Process::created_at` primitive (sibling to the TTL-expiry gate
397 // in `evaluate` above); the `let-else` short-circuits on the
398 // missing-slot corner to the caller's `default` sleep budget.
399 let Some(creation) = process.created_at() else {
400 return default;
401 };
402 // Shared TTL-parse projection with [`evaluate`] above — the
403 // `humantime::parse_duration(&<eph>.ttl).ok()` chain rides through
404 // the ONE substrate primitive
405 // [`crate::lifetime::EphemeralLifetime::ttl_duration`]. The
406 // `let-else` short-circuits on the parse-failure corner (typo,
407 // unsupported unit, non-humantime literal on the wire) to the
408 // caller's `default` sleep budget — the same "no ttl data → do
409 // not fire the timed decision" interpretation the TTL-expiry
410 // gate in [`evaluate`] gives to the `None` arm.
411 let Some(ttl) = e.ttl_duration() else {
412 return default;
413 };
414 // Sibling to the TTL-expiry gate in [`evaluate`] above: the
415 // `(now, creation) → Option<std::time::Duration>` projection rides
416 // through the ONE substrate primitive [`crate::time::elapsed_since`].
417 // The `let-else` short-circuits on the negative-anchor corner
418 // (clock skew or a creation timestamp stamped past `now`) to the
419 // caller's `default` sleep budget — the same "no elapsed data → do
420 // not fire the timed decision" interpretation every other consumer
421 // gives to the `None` arm.
422 let Some(elapsed) = crate::time::elapsed_since(now, creation) else {
423 return default;
424 };
425 let remaining = ttl.checked_sub(elapsed).unwrap_or(Duration::from_secs(0));
426 // Never sleep less than 1s; never longer than the default heartbeat.
427 let pick = std::cmp::min(default, remaining);
428 std::cmp::max(pick, Duration::from_secs(1))
429}
